Clear All Filters
Plush Velvet Easy Clean/Juniper Green Ashford Relaxed Sit
£1,599
Plush Velvet Easy Clean/Airforce Blue Heath Highback
£1,399
Plush Velvet Easy Clean/Ginger Orange Heath Highback
Plush Velvet Easy Clean/Navy Blue Stamford
£1,350
Plush Velvet Easy Clean/Juniper Green Heath Highback
Plush Velvet Easy Clean/Airforce Blue Michigan Ii
£1,199
Plush Velvet Easy Clean/Juniper Green Ashford
£1,550
Plush Velvet Easy Clean/Ginger Orange Ashford
Plush Velvet Easy Clean/Airforce Blue Houghton Deep Relaxed Sit
£1,525
Plush Velvet Easy Clean/Airforce Blue Ashford Relaxed Sit